Another notable feature of True Love is its PUA encoding. This means that users can access all of the glyphs and swashes with ease, allowing for greater flexibility in design. Whether you're looking to add flourishes, alternate characters, or custom variations, True Love offers the tools needed to create something truly unique.

Recommendations for Using True Love
To get the most out of True Love, consider the following recommendations:
- Use it for emphasis: Apply True Love to headlines, titles, or key phrases to draw attention and add visual interest.
- Pair it with complementary fonts: Combine True Love with a sans-serif or serif font to create contrast and balance in your design.
- Experiment with size and spacing: Adjust the font size and letter spacing to achieve the desired effect, whether it's bold and striking or subtle and refined.
